...FLASH FLOOD WATCH FOR THE BOLT CREEK BURN SCAR IN EFFECT THROUGH
LATE MONDAY NIGHT...
* WHAT...Flash flooding and debris flows caused by excessive
rainfall are possible over the Bolt Creek burn scar.
* WHERE...A portion of west central Washington, including the
following area, West Slopes North Central Cascades and Passes.
* WHEN...Through late Monday night.
* IMPACTS...Heavy rainfall over the Bolt Creek burn scar is expected
during the period of the watch. Residents near the Bolt Creek burn
scar should prepare for potential flooding impacts. Be sure to
stay up to date with information from local authorities. Heavy
rainfall could trigger flash flooding of low-lying areas,
urbanized street flooding, and debris flows in and near recent
wildfire burn scars.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
- National Weather Service Meteorologists are forecasting heavy
rainfall over the burn scar, which may lead to flash flooding
and debris flows.
